Cal Farley's Girlstown, U.S.A.

The Cal Farley’s Girlstown, U.S.A. Transitional Living Program (TLP) serves girls who are at risk of not completing their high school education. The population is comprised of 16- to 23-year-old girls who need to complete their high school education, gain independent living skills and obtain employment or enrollment in a vocational program, college program, or the military in a relatively short period of time. Average length of stay ranges from 1 to 1 ½ years; however, actual length of stay will be based on the individual. Candidates for the program must agree to work toward completion of program goals as well as individual plan of service goals. Upon successful completion of the program residents will have met the following:

     ·        High School Diploma
·        Driver’s License
·        Socially Responsible
·        Self-Sufficient
·        Substance Free
·        Gainful Employment and/or Vocational Program Enrollment, College Program Enrollment, Military Enrollment
·        Financially Responsible
·        Safe living place secured prior to departure from the program
·        Minimum departure savings of $1,000.00
